London Night

Saturday 20th April saw our Short Mat Club Captain Rosemary Dunkley receive a surprise celebration for her 80th birthday. Some of our club’s best social events are those that are not part of the formal Social Events calendar.

Here is Rosemary, dressed as a Pearly Queen, sat beside her beautiful birthday cake., at the start of the evening.

Shirley and Mick Collins, our relentless “Event Organisers” really pushed the boat out with this one! Both organizing and hosting a themed “London Night” for all to enjoy.

Every one came along in a variety of “London” fancy dress outfits. From a raven from the Tower of London, chimney sweeps, spivs, and even our King and Queen. There were a number of entertainments, from some lovely short acts with some great joviality for club members, a “guess the London landmark” picture quiz, horse racing with real live club members and a sing-along to round off proceedings.

Many thanks to Mick and Shirley, and those who help with all the preparations and food, and to all those who turned up. Fabulous evening.
